The war of words between Education Cabinet Secretary Fred Matiang’i and Kisii Governor James Ongwae seems to be far from over as vote hunt in the Gusii region intensifies.
On Sunday, Matiang’i had accused Ongwae of hijacking his meetings in the region and warned that he would not ‘tolerate’ the habit anymore.
But in a rejoinder, Ongwae accused Matiang’i of deviating from his jurisdictions and subsequently engaging in politics against the law.
“He is not allowed to participate in politics and as a former civil servant, I want to caution him because this could sabotage his career in future,” Ongwae said.
He added: “Let us compete maturely. In fact, I do not belong to his league because I was elected while he is just an appointee trying to protect his job using skewed tactics.”
While Ongwae is a point’s man for opposition leader Raila Odinga, Matiang’i has been rallying for President Uhuru Kenyatta’s reelection.
With Jubilee zoning Gusii region as a swing region, Mr. Ongwae has been rallying for locals to remain in opposition, which they voted for overwhelmingly in 2013.
